The global Seat Vibration Alert Controller Market is gaining remarkable momentum as automotive safety systems rapidly evolve. With automakers prioritizing occupant protection and advanced driver assistance technologies, seat vibration alert controllers are emerging as essential components in modern vehicles. These systems provide haptic feedback to alert drivers about road hazards, lane departures, and collision risks, significantly improving response times.
As the automotive industry embraces automation, electrification, and intelligent cabin technologies, the demand for vibration-based alert systems continues to rise. These controllers integrate seamlessly with detection modules, ADAS sensors, and user-oriented safety frameworks. Their role in preventing distractions and enhancing situational awareness is driving strong adoption across passenger and commercial vehicles.

Market Overview
The Seat Vibration Alert Controller Market is projected to expand steadily as regulators and consumers increasingly favor enhanced vehicle safety features. The integration of haptic warning systems complements visual and audio alerts, offering a multi-layered approach to driver assistance. This strengthens the overall performance of ADAS platforms.
Manufacturers are focusing on improving product accuracy, vibration intensity control, ergonomics, and compatibility with advanced vehicle electronics. These improvements support more intuitive and effective safety alerts, contributing to growing market demand.
The market includes vibration motors, controller units, signal processors, and integrated sensor interfaces. These components offer precise, immediate tactile feedback, making them essential for high-performance safety systems.
Key Market Drivers
Strong market growth is supported by several drivers:
Rise in Advanced Driver Assistance Systems (ADAS): Seat vibration alerts enhance driver attention, especially in high-risk conditions.
Increasing Road Safety Regulations: Governments worldwide are endorsing safety-enhancing cabin technologies.
Growing Focus on Driver Comfort and Awareness: Haptic alerts reduce noise fatigue and support non-intrusive communication.
Adoption of Electrified Vehicle Platforms: EV architectures facilitate the integration of intelligent seat-based warning systems.
These drivers reflect the global shift toward safer and more responsive vehicle ecosystems.
Market Restraints
While market growth is promising, several challenges influence adoption:
Higher Integration Costs: Advanced alert controllers require premium sensors and complex wiring.
Technology Compatibility Issues: Ensuring seamless interaction with diverse vehicle models is a persistent challenge.
Limited Awareness in Developing Regions: Consumers may not fully understand the benefits of haptic safety systems.
Despite these barriers, increased safety awareness and regulatory support continue to boost market acceptance.
